Submitted papers are evaluated by anonymous referees by single blind peer review for contribution, originality, relevance, and presentation. The Editor shall inform you of the results of the review as soon as possible, hopefully in 10 weeks. Please notice that because of the great number of submissions that TELKOMNIKA has received during the last few months the duration of the review process can be up to 14 weeks. A Technical Review of BMS Performance Standard for Electric Vehicle Applications in Indonesia Wahyudi Sutopo; Budhy Rahmawatie; Fakhrina Fahma; Muhammad Nizam; Agus Purwanto; B.B Louhenapessy; Evizal Abdul Kadir

Abstract

The development of Battery Management System (BMS) standards in Indonesia has been carried out causing the FACTS approach. That's approach makes it possible to accommodate all stakeholder requirements. However, the approach has not yet considered a technical review of the regulated standards. Based on this, this study undertook a comprehensive review of BMS performance parameters set out in the standard. In order that the regulated standards not only accommodate the needs of stakeholders but also consider BMS technical studies in order not to impede the future development of BMS.
Error Performance Analysis in Underwater Acoustic Noise With Non-Gaussian Distribution Nor Shahida Mohd Shah; Yasin Yousif Al-Aboosi; Musatafa Sami Ahmed

Abstract

There is a high demand for underwater communication systems due to the increase in current social underwater activities. The assumption of Gaussian noise allows the use of Traditional communication systems. However, the non-Gaussian nature of underwater acoustic noise (UWAN) results in the poor performance of such systems. This study presents an experimental model for the noise of the acoustic underwater channel in tropical shallow water at Desaru beach on the eastern shore of Johor in Malaysia, on the South China Sea with the use of broadband hydrophones. A probability density function of the noise amplitude distribution is proposed and its parameters defined. Furthermore, an expression of the probability of symbol error for binary signalling is presented for the channel in order to verify the noise effect on the performance of underwater acoustic communication binary signalling systems.

Abstract

Recently chaos-based encryption has been obtained more and more attention. Chaotic systems without equilibria may be suitable to be used to design pseudorandom number generators (PRNGs) because there does not exist corresponding chaos criterion theorem on such systems. This paper proposes two propositions on 4-dimensional systems without equilibria. Using one of the propositions introduces a chaotic system without equilibria. Using this system and the generalized chaos synchronization (GCS) theorem constructs an 8-dimensional discrete generalized chaos synchronization (8DBDGCS) system. Using the 8DBDGCS system designs a 216-word chaotic PRNG. Simulation results show that there are no significant correlations between the key stream and the perturbed key streams generated via the 216-word chaotic PRNG. The key space of the chaotic PRNG is larger than 21275. As an application, the chaotic PRNG is used with an avalanche-encryption scheme to encrypt an RGB image. The results demonstrate that the chaotic PRNG is able to generate the avalanche effects which are similar to those generated via ideal chaotic PRNGs.

Abstract

Complexity in finding property on property exhibition which consider many related constraints is quite high. Customers need to spend much time to analyse the right property to buy depends on their constraints whether salary, distance to work, facility, etc. According to the problem, this research will collect the information from customer on property exhibition to find out the constraint. Also, this research will focus on design and analyses the decision support system for property exhibition. Software development life cycle that will be used is scrum which is divided into several processes like backlog, sprints, scrum meetings, and demos. The result of this research is a web application that help customer to collect the information of the property according to their constraints.
